Bathinda, August 10
A one-year-old boy on Tuesday died after his mother allegedly poisoned him. After this, she poisoned her three-year-old daughter, and then took the toxic substance herself at Mandi Kalan Village at Bathinda district.
The three-year-old girl is struggling for her life.
Even the condition of the mother is “serious, and she along with her daughter are undergoing treatment at a private hospital here”.
Ballianwali police have registered a case of murder against the mother.
The one-year-old deceased boy has been identified as Gurpreet Singh. “An investigation is underway. The reason behind this remains unknown,” the police said.
Jagtar Singh—a resident of Mandi Kalan Village—told the police that he was married to Manpreet Kaur four years ago. Now, he has two children. When he returned from work two days ago, his wife was beating his daughter. She was also “threatening to kill the children by
giving them poison”.
On Sunday, his wife went through with it. She poisoned both the children and “swallowed the poison herself”.
As soon as he came to know, he reached home and rushed all three to the Civil Hospital, Rampura, where the doctors referred them to Bathinda. His one-year-old son Gurpreet Singh died on the way, while three-year-old daughter Husanpreet Kaur and his wife Manpreet Kaur are under treatment at the hospital.
Meanwhile, Investigating Officer ASI Kuldeep Singh said that based on the statement of Jagtar Singh, a case of murder has been registered against Manpreet Kaur and the next action has been started.
The woman will be arrested on release from the hospital. A case under sections 302, 207 and 309 of IPC has been registered against the accused mother Manpreet Kaur at Ballianwali police station.
